Gladys O'Connor
Born: 28th Nov 1903 East London, England, UK - Died 21st Feb 2012
Dept: Acting
Gladys O'Connor was born on November 28, 1903 in East London, England, UK. She was an actress, known for The Long Kiss Goodnight (1996), Billy Madison (1995) and Half Baked (1998). She died on February 21, 2012 in Toronto, Ontario, Canada.
